本篇文章给大家谈谈安卓基本开发,以及安卓开发工具有哪些对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
Android开发需要什么基础
对于java基础,我现在的感觉是 如果要深入学习android平台,Java基础一定要好(里边包括各种j***a类库的用法,本地代码jni什么的)。但如果平时随便做做应用的话,会面向对象编程就完全可以了。
掌握Android 四大组件知识,深入了解相关生命周期,对于application、Fragment、Intent常见的开发知识也必须掌握。
拥有娴熟的J***a基础,理解设计模式,比如OOP语言的工厂模式要懂得。.掌握AndroidUI控件、AndroidJ***a层api相关使用。
Android开发环境搭建:Android介绍,Android开发环境搭建,先进个Android应用程序,Android应用程序目录结构。
Android开发,需要掌握以下知识:android以j***a为基础的,所以前提要学好J***a基础知识,比如基本类型、***等。android api,学习基本的Activity、service、intent等基本的知识,可以开发一些界面。计算机网络基本知识。
界面开发是一种基本的技术,几乎所有的程序里面都需要用到。
如何进行Android应用的开发
HybridApp已成为开发***不错的选择,是未来移动应用开发的趋势。 原生***开发方法 以开发工具的不同来分类,原生***的开发方式有两种:Eclipse+ADT和AndroidStudio。
国内制作工具***Can。***Can是国内的一个移动应用开发平台,支持跨平台应用开发,支持Hybrid ***的开发和运行。***Can应用引擎提供的Native交互能力,可以让HTML5开发的移动应用基本接Native ***的体验。
首先产品经理通过调研整理需求,然后把需求整理成页面(可以用墨刀等网页制作),然后交给UI人员进行专业的设计美化,最后把设计图打包给开发者。
至此开发环境配置完成,接下来即可以进行Android上应用的开发。第一个Android应用程序(Hello,Android World!) 新建项目:打开Eclipse,选择FileNewProjectAndroid Project 点击“Next”,这里仅为演示,不创建测试项目。
学习安卓开发需要什么基础?
首先要熟悉学习Android开发要具备哪些基础知识。J***a作为学习Android开发的基础编程语言,掌握J***a开发基础知识是非常重要的。另外,还要重点掌握针对Android平台而特有的Activity、Service、Broadcast、ContentProvider、Handler等知识。
学习Android开发并不需要基础,零基础的人也可以学习,只是在学习过程中学的比较慢,当然有基础更好,学习进度更快,问题也更少,最好懂一点J***a基础,或者其他任意一门语言(如c语言、[_a***_]、c#等)。
目前前端开发后端化趋势也比较明显,掌握一定的后端知识也是有必要的。 在掌握以上内容之后就可以学习具体的Android开发了,Android开发需要学习的内容包括Activity、Intent、ContentProvider、Fragment、Service等内容。
J***a编程语言:J***a是Android开发的核心语言,因此你需要熟练掌握J***a编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
由于安卓应用开发语言用的是J***a语言,所以学习安卓手机软件开发首先要具备一定的j***a语言基础。
安卓电子产品的不断冲击国际市场,安卓相关的软件也越来越多,安卓工程师的市场需求也水涨船高,可以说,android工程师是一个越来越受欢迎的IT职业之一。本文将为大家介绍入门学习android需要做哪些准备。
Android的开发技术
看你将来想从来哪方面的开发。ANROID的开发分为:1)、Android客户端应用程序 如新浪微博、网银客户端、凡客、淘宝客户端,快盘客户端。Android在这里的应用还是界面层的东西为主。核心还在WEB。
熟悉j***a编程语言,android应用程序开发是以j***a语言为基础的,所以没有扎实的j***a基础知识,如果只是简单机械的照抄照搬别人的代码,是没有任何意义的。
第一个层次和传统的嵌入式Linux最接近,主要涉及的是CPU、GPU以及外设的驱动以及使能方面。需要熟悉Linux内核,Android框架定义中驱动的接口规范等等,这部分开源社区的力量最大。
主要需要掌握的技能:蓝牙通信/串口/DLNA/Automotive系统/车载进程通信/CarLauncher开发/车载多媒体。Android前言技术 主要需要掌握的技能:自动化构建***/前言编译插件技术/Compose基础/Compose进阶。
,Android进阶高级:蓝牙/WIFI SMS/MMS 应用实现 深层次解析GPS原理。
原生***开发方法 以开发工具的不同来分类,原生***的开发方式有两种:Eclipse+ADT和AndroidStudio。 Eclipse+ADT Eclipse+ADT的开发方式是曾经Android开发者最好的选择,也是谷歌官方所支持的。
安卓基本开发的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于安卓开发工具有哪些、安卓基本开发的信息别忘了在本站进行查找喔。